Why These Are the Top Nissan Repair Auto Repair Shops in Seaboard

** The Nissan repair market for Seaboard, NC, is characterized by its reliance on nearby regional hubs, primarily Roanoke Rapids (~15-20 minute drive) and Rocky Mount (~35-40 minute drive). There is no dedicated Nissan dealership or specialist within the town itself. The competition level in the immediate area is low, but the surrounding region offers a healthy mix of general auto repair shops and a few import specialists. The average quality of service for Nissan-specific work is good, with several shops in Roanoke Rapids demonstrating proven competency with common Nissan issues like CVT servicing and electrical diagnostics. For high-performance models like the GT-R, owners would likely need to travel to Rocky Mount or even the Raleigh-Durham area for true expert-level care. Typical pricing is competitive with regional averages, generally lower than dealership labor rates but higher than that of a general handyman mechanic. Expect to pay **$110 - $140 per hour** for labor at the specialized shops listed. Given the rural nature of Seaboard, sourcing specific parts for less common models may sometimes cause minor delays, but the established shops have robust supply chains to mitigate this.

What are the most common Nissan repairs needed by drivers in the Seaboard, NC area?

In Seaboard, common Nissan issues include CVT transmission fluid service due to heat and stop-and-go driving, brake system wear from rural road conditions, and air conditioning repairs crucial for our humid summers. Older models like the Altima or Rogue may also need attention for exhaust components due to road salt residue from winter travel.

How can I find a reputable, local mechanic in Seaboard for my Nissan?

Seek shops with ASE-certified technicians, specifically those with Nissan or Japanese brand experience. Check reviews from local customers in Northampton County and ask if they use genuine Nissan or high-quality aftermarket parts. A trustworthy shop will provide clear estimates and explain repairs needed for Seaboard's specific driving environment.

When should I seek service for my Nissan's CVT transmission around Seaboard?

You should seek service immediately if you notice hesitation, jerking, or whining noises, especially after driving on hot rural highways. Nissan recommends regular CVT fluid inspections and changes more frequently than traditional transmissions, which is critical for longevity given our area's temperature swings and often dusty back roads.

Are repair costs for Nissans generally higher in Seaboard comp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in Seaboard can be slightly lower than in major metros like Raleigh, but parts costs are similar. The main advantage is supporting local businesses that understand regional issues like pothole damage from country roads or preparing your vehicle for seasonal humidity. Always get a written estimate before work begins.

What local driving conditions in the Seaboard area should I consider for Nissan maintenance?

Consider our mix of rural highways, agricultural roads with dust/debris, and high summer humidity. This means more frequent cabin air filter changes, vigilant tire and suspension checks for pothole damage, and ensuring cooling systems are robust for summer heat. Preparing your Nissan for these conditions prevents larger repairs.
